Transaction 70e018077fb323cf55d16c64584f333ff5802c5a19efda40549e54a79fae87fc
1 Input
2 Outputs
- 70e018077fb323cf55d16c64584f333ff5802c5a19efda40549e54a79fae87fc:0
- 70e018077fb323cf55d16c64584f333ff5802c5a19efda40549e54a79fae87fc:1
value 775700
address 1EQocteUjHujW9FQYrpmarSEK233ejkFgk
value 27973257213
address 1ECsGdn5tNKxJukDupkAjLGnWTJZ6fjqS